How they compare
Lesotho currently reports 1,721 hectares against 510 hectares in Mauritania, a difference of 1,211 hectares.
That makes Lesotho's figure about 3.4 times Mauritania's.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 51 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Lesotho ahead.
Lesotho ranks 13th and Mauritania ranks 15th of 17 countries.
Lesotho has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Lesotho | Mauritania |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 2,978 hectares | 304.44 hectares | 2,674 hectares | Lesotho |
| 1970s | 1,163 hectares | 264 hectares | 899 hectares | Lesotho |
| 1980s | 1,270 hectares | 357 hectares | 913 hectares | Lesotho |
| 1990s | 1,308 hectares | 373.3 hectares | 934.3 hectares | Lesotho |
| 2000s | 1,220 hectares | 488.9 hectares | 730.7 hectares | Lesotho |
| 2010s | 1,908 hectares | 505 hectares | 1,402 hectares | Lesotho |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
Land under barley production refers to harvested area, although some countries report only sown or cultivated area. Production data on relate to crop harvested for dry grain only. Crop harvested for hay or harvested green for food, feed, or silage and those used for grazing are excluded.
